Output dd1428a588f105ba0a1bd08e1a17287f30d8e6eba90d0e25652d60dd7b340bc9:0

value
446570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3d68da902b8df9ba9baf4f1072863b56a4f444 OP_EQUAL
address
35iwDoBZpLYr1wEQMuwATH3mPYXfPQCBd8
transaction
dd1428a588f105ba0a1bd08e1a17287f30d8e6eba90d0e25652d60dd7b340bc9
spent
true